One thing I find really annoying in UVLayout is how hitting the F key when not over a shell, causes a menu to appear down the bottom. You have to hit enter to continue. This happens to me a lot when I am relaxing smaller objects that move from under the mouse while I am holding down F.
Is there a way to make it just do nothing when I press it over empty space or do I just have to live with it?

Try using Space-F instead of F by itself. If you do that, the shell keeps on flattening until you tap space to stop; you don't need to hold down any keys while its flattening, so if the shell drifts from under the cursor, its not an issue.
